Bitcoin Demand Warning: CryptoQuant Signals Alarming Shift to Bear Market
Is the Bitcoin bull run losing steam? According to a crucial report from on-chain analytics firm CryptoQuant, a significant slowdown in Bitcoin demand growth suggests we might be entering a bear market phase. This analysis points to weakening fundamentals that every crypto investor needs to understand.
CryptoQuant’s Friday report delivered sobering news for the crypto community. The platform’s data shows that the surge in spot Bitcoin demand, which powered much of this year’s rally, has fallen below its upward trendline since early October. This represents a fundamental shift in market dynamics that could have serious implications for Bitcoin’s price trajectory.

CryptoQuant explains this slowdown indicates that accumulation demand for the current cycle has likely been absorbed. Think of it like a sponge that can’t hold any more water. This removes a crucial pillar of price support that has sustained Bitcoin’s value throughout recent months.
More concerning, the analysis reveals that demand from institutions and large-scale investors has entered a contraction phase. These “whales” typically provide market stability, so their retreat signals deeper concerns about market conditions. Meanwhile, risk appetite in the derivatives market is also weakening, suggesting traders are becoming more cautious.
History provides valuable context for understanding current Bitcoin demand trends. CryptoQuant notes that historically, a bear market often follows when demand growth peaks and reverses. This pattern holds true regardless of supply-side dynamics, making demand indicators particularly important for forecasting market direction.
